Impressive Start to
Year for Bulldogs
The Daily Mountain Eagle
Published January 04, 2006 1:17 AM CST DORA
-- Dora won its first game of 2006 as the Bulldogs cruised Tuesday
night to a 83-41 victory over Hayden.
The Bulldogs jumped out to a 16-8 lead after the first quarter and
held a 35-14 advantage at the half.
Hayden kept things close until Dora closed the first half with a
17-0 run. Whit Wright sparked the run with three steals and six
points. Wright's behind-the-back pass to Brandon Yancey gave Dora
a 31-14 lead. Wright added a basket with 46 seconds left and Landon
Hayes hit a shot with 18 seconds remaining left to close the half.
Dora also outscored Hayden 28-10 in the final frame.
"It was a good win to start after Christmas," said Dora
head coach Bart Payne. "We played good team ball and passed
up good shots to get better shots."
Dora (10-6) had four players crack double digits in the victory.
Wright led the Bulldogs with 18 points, Isiah Doaty scored 15 and
Kyle Chance and Anthony Valdez added 10 points each.
The Bulldogs next game will be at Fayette on Friday.
Dora girls 67,
Hayden 33
Three Dora players scored in double figures as the Lady Bulldogs
beat Hayden handily on Tuesday night.
Kimber Holt led the way with 20 points and seven rebounds. Kayla
Smiley had 16 points and seven rebounds and Chantrese Softley had
14 points.
Kayla James had nine rebounds and six steals, Erica Jones added
nine steals and Stephanie Woods tallied five steals.
Dora had 26 steals in the game.
Dora (8-7) led 19-8 after the first quarter and 32-18 at the half.
